Chapter on the Implementation of Legal Punishments on the Mute, the Deaf, and the Blind

Hadith.5131 - Yunus narrated from Ishaq ibn Ammar who said that one of the two Imams (peace be upon them) was asked about the legal punishments (hudud) for a mute, a deaf person, and a blind person. Imam (as) said: "The legal punishments apply to them if they comprehend what they are doing."
